Segredos Do Ninja Javascript Download Pdf

Segredos Do Ninja Javascript Download Pdf

4 min read Jun 18, 2024
Segredos Do Ninja Javascript Download Pdf

Segredos do Ninja JavaScript: Dominando a Arte da Programação Web

O JavaScript é uma linguagem poderosa e versátil, essencial para a criação de aplicações web interativas e dinâmicas. Se você busca dominar essa arte e se tornar um verdadeiro ninja JavaScript, este guia é para você!

Desvendando os Segredos:

1. Fundamentos Sólidos:

  • Compreenda os Conceitos Básicos: Domine as variáveis, tipos de dados, operadores, estruturas de controle (condicionais e loops) e funções.
  • Objeto JavaScript: Aprenda a trabalhar com objetos, suas propriedades e métodos, e como criar seus próprios objetos personalizados.
  • Arrays e Matrizes: Explore arrays e matrizes para armazenar e manipular dados, utilizando seus métodos e propriedades.

2. Domine o DOM:

  • Navegue pelo Modelo de Objeto do Documento (DOM): Utilize o DOM para acessar e manipular elementos HTML, modificar seu conteúdo, estilo e comportamento.
  • Eventos e Interações: Aprenda a lidar com eventos do usuário, como cliques, movimentos do mouse e carregamento de páginas, para criar interfaces responsivas.
  • Manipulação Dinâmica de Conteúdo: Use o JavaScript para adicionar, remover, modificar e atualizar conteúdo HTML em tempo real.

3. JavaScript Avançado:

  • Funções de Alta Ordem: Explore o poder das funções de alta ordem, como map, filter, reduce, para manipular arrays de forma eficiente.
  • Closures: Entenda o conceito de closures e como elas permitem criar funções com escopo privado e memória persistente.
  • Prototipos e Herança: Explore a natureza baseada em protótipos do JavaScript para criar e reutilizar código de forma eficiente.

4. Bibliotecas e Frameworks:

  • jQuery: Domine essa biblioteca popular para simplificar a manipulação do DOM e a interação com eventos.
  • React, Angular, Vue: Explore os frameworks modernos para a construção de aplicações web complexas e escaláveis.

5. Boas Práticas e Desempenho:

  • Escreva código limpo e legível: Utilize boas práticas de nomenclatura, indentação e comentários para facilitar a manutenção e a colaboração.
  • Otimize o desempenho: Utilize técnicas para minimizar o uso de recursos e garantir a fluidez da aplicação.
  • Teste seu código: Implemente testes unitários para garantir a qualidade e a robustez do seu código.

6. Continue Aprendendo:

  • Recursos Online: Utilize sites como MDN Web Docs, W3Schools, FreeCodeCamp e Codecademy para aprender e praticar.
  • Comunidades: Participe de fóruns e grupos online para trocar conhecimentos e tirar dúvidas.
  • Projetos Pessoais: Crie projetos próprios para colocar em prática seus conhecimentos e desenvolver suas habilidades.

Concluindo:

Este guia oferece um ponto de partida para sua jornada de aprendizado em JavaScript. Com dedicação e prática, você dominará a linguagem e se tornará um verdadeiro ninja JavaScript, capaz de criar aplicações web inovadoras e impactantes.

Lembre-se: A prática é fundamental! Mergulhe em projetos, experimente, erre e aprenda com seus erros. Com o tempo, você se tornará um mestre no controle do JavaScript e poderá criar aplicações web incríveis!

Related Post